Ibalik was created from a simple truth:
People deserve more than temporary help, they deserve hope, stability, and dignity.

We saw too many families praying for a miracle each month just to cover the basics. Too many good people feeling forgotten. Too many communities surviving, but not living.

So we asked a different question:
What if charity wasn’t just a moment of generosity, but a system of ongoing support?

What if technology, trading, and compassion could work together to restore lives?

Ibalik was born from that vision, a place where purpose meets innovation, where help isn’t given once, but flows like a river.

We believe every act of kindness releases a ripple effect… one that reaches farther than we can imagine.
